COMMUNITY NEWS
- ➤ The Bluegrass Legends Experience III is a multi-day event running from August 15 to today at Moreland Park and the Owensboro Sportscenter with a car show featuring over 800 vehicles, live music, vendors, food trucks and a swap meet — benefiting St. Jude Children's Research Hospital. The award ceremony will take place at 1:30 p.m. inside the sportscenter. 44 News
BUSINESS NEWS
- ➤ Spirit Halloween returns to Owensboro this fall by opening a store in the former Joann Fabrics building at 5241 Frederica Street, Suite 3 — customers are advised to check the Spirit website for the most up-to-date details as store hours expand closer to the holiday. The Owensboro Times
CULTURE NEWS
- ➤ Meg Shaffer, an Owensboro native who loved reading from an early age, became a national bestseller and credits her supportive school system & library for sparking her writing career. She will release a new standalone novel next year to share more stories with readers. The Owensboro Times
GOVERNMENT NEWS
- ➤ The Sheriff's Office and Oliver's Heroes K-9 dedicated the new Joe Sells K-9 Training Facility at 5900 Kansas Road on August 16th—honoring Joe Sells, the founder of Oliver's Heroes who supported the department's K-9 program—with Sheriff Noah Robinson delivering remarks, a K-9 demonstration, and a donor lunch. Officials said the event celebrated community support and marked a new chapter in local K-9 training. 44 News
SPORTS NEWS
- ➤ Daviess County girls’ golf finished third at the Eagle Invitational today with a team score of 321—six strokes behind first-place Marshall County as they used the tournament to prepare for Semi-State amid rough course conditions. The Owensboro Times
